Abstract
In a wireless communication system, a central control unit 31 comprises a synchronizing means for synchronizing a frame for an base station-mobile station communication with that for an inter-mobile station direct communication based on control information used for the base station-mobile station communication, when a second frequency is used for the inter-mobile station direct communication which is different from a first frequency used for the base station-mobile station communication. The central control unit 31 also comprises an allocation means for allocating a band and a frequency for the inter-mobile station direct communication in accordance with an allocation request from a base station 30 or a mobile station 40. Frames for the base station-mobile station communication and the inter-mobile station direct communication are synchronized by utilizing control information 55 for the base station-mobile station communication instead of the conventional control information provided by the mobile station. The system allows a base station-mobile station communication to take place even when an inter-mobile station direct communication is conducted at a frequency other than that of the base station. As the base station controls the inter-mobile station direct communication, the burden on the mobile stations can be reduced, and a single base station can use multiple frequencies simultaneously.

8. A wireless communication system comprised of:
-
a base station, a first terminal, and a second terminal, the wireless communication system carrying out base station-terminal wireless data communication and inter-terminal direct wireless data communication by use of a first frequency band, wherein the first terminal and the second terminal carry out the inter-terminal direct wireless data communication in a state of being connected to the base station; a wireless access system employs not a frequency hopping system but a CSMA/CA and/or TDMA/TDD system as the wireless access system, and thus, the first frequency band is not periodically changed to another frequency band during data communication; in addition to the first frequency band, a second frequency band different from the first frequency band is available for the wireless data communication; wireless data transmission at the first frequency band and the wireless data transmission at the second frequency band can be simultaneously carried out; a transmission frame at the first frequency band is time-synchronized with the transmission frame at the second frequency band; and the time synchronization is realized by a control signal transmitted from the base station at the first frequency band, and at the second frequency band, the control signal for the time synchronization is not transmitted; a request signal, for setting up inter-terminal direct wireless data communication between the first terminal and the second terminal, is transmitted from the second terminal to the base station; a response signal of the request signal is transmitted from the base station to the first terminal; and wherein the second frequency band, which is used for the inter-terminal direct wireless data communication between the first terminal and the second terminal, is notified to the first terminal and the second terminal by use of the control signal transmitted from the base station.
